"What's Your Emergency," released in 2023, invites players to step into the shoes of a 911 operator, engaging in a unique blend of casual and indie gameplay. Players respond to various emergencies by interacting with victims and leveraging the advanced "Emergency_Manager_2.0" application. Its focus on dialogue and problem-solving sets it apart from traditional action games, making it a notable entry in the genre.
